2019独角兽企业重金招聘Python工程师标准>>>

1.初始化一个Git仓库:git init

2.添加文件到仓库:git add file

3.提交文件到仓库:git commit -m""

4.当前工作区状态:git status

5.查看文件修改内容:git diff

6.查看提交历史:git log

查看命令历史:git reflog

回到某一版本:git reset --hard

7.撤销工作区修改:git checkout --file

撤销暂存区修改:git reset HEAD file

8.删除文件:git rm file

9.本地仓库推送到Github仓库:git remote add origin git@github.com:finndai/learngit.git

10.推送master分支所有内容:git push -u origin master(第一次)

git push origin master

11.本地克隆远程库:git clone  git@github.com:finndai/learngit.git

12.查看分支:git branch

13.创建分支:git branch (name)

14.切换分支:git checkout (name)

15创建和切换分支:git checkout -b (name)

16.合并分支:git merge (name)

17.删除分支:git branch -d (name)

18.查看分支合并图:git log --graph --pretty=oneline abbrev-commit

19.保存工作现场:git stash

20.回到工作现场:git stash pop

21.分支未合并强行删除:git branch -D(name)

22.查看远程库信息:git remote -v

23.从本地推送信息:git push origin branch-name

24.远程抓取:git pull

25.建立本地和远程的关联:git branch --set-upstream branch-name origin/branch-name

26.git tag (name): 创建标签

27.git tag -a (tagname) -m "balalaall" 指定标签信息

28.git tag -s (tagname) -m "balalaall" 可以用PGP签名标签信息

git tag -u "gpg姓名"-s (tagname) -m "balalaall"

29. git tag :查看所有标签

30.git tag -d (tagname):删除标签

31.git config --global alias.st staus:举例配置别名

.

转载于:https://my.oschina.net/finndai/blog/818815

Git初学使用命令记录相关推荐

  1. git 部分常用命令记录

    git checkout release/aaagit loggit pullgit branch -agit add .git commit -m 'feat: aa'git commit --am ...

  2. 记录一下git 的常用命令

    以后如果要写一个东西,最好先搭建一个本地仓库,用版本控制对其进行操作,可能一开始有一些麻烦,但是很有可能会受益无穷. 说到git,必然会和github联系起来. 不管是在ubuntu里面还是在Wind ...

  3. Git(6)-- 记录每次更新到仓库图文版(git clone、status、add、diff、commit、rm、mv命令详解)

    文章目录 1.克隆现有仓库:`git clone` 2.检查当前文件状态 :`git status` 3.跟踪新文件:`git add` 4.暂存已修改的文件:`git add` 5.状态简览: `g ...

  4. Git基础(常用命令)介绍

    版本控制是一种记录若干文件内容变化,以便将来查阅特定版本修订情况的系统. 关于版本控制分为三种:本地版本控制系统,如rcs:集中化的版本控制系统,如CVS.SVN:分布式版本控制系统,如Git. Gi ...

  5. Git npm相关命令

    Git 相关命令 查看用户名和密码 配置用户名和密码 查看git项目远程地址 添加git远程仓库 查看提交记录 查看已有tag 打标签 在某次提交记录上打标签 推送标签到远程 推送单个指定tag到远程 ...

  6. Git系列之git log高级命令

    原文地址 使用任何版本控制工具的目的都在于记录你代码的变化.这可以给予你查看项目历史的能力,去发现谁做出了贡献,弄清楚何时产生了bug,回滚到错误的修改.但是,如果你无法定位,获取这些历史记录将变得毫 ...

  7. Git使用教程-命令总结大全

    /在 cmd 上操作/ git help          // 帮助信息  常用git命令  和解释 git help -a      // 命令目录 git help -g      //手册 g ...

  8. git log 查看提交记录,参数:

    git log 查看提交记录,参数: -n (n是一个正整数),查看最近n次的提交信息 $ git log -2 查看最近2次的提交历史记录 -- fileName fileName为任意文件名,查看 ...

  9. Git操作手册|命令速查表

    Git操作手册|命令速查表 这篇文章主要介绍Git分布式版本管理与集中式管理的一些差异,总结下Git常用命令作为日后的速查表,最后介绍Git进阶的一些案例. 本文分为以下几个部分: Git与SVN差异 ...

最新文章

  1. python估计物体角度
  2. 【工具推荐】Hadoop集群监控工具 HTools
  3. python中多维数组_python学习笔记-多维数组
  4. HTML5权威指南 11.通信API
  5. Asp.net MVC在Razor中输出Html的两种方式
  6. Apprentissage du français partie 3
  7. mp4 视频在网页上播放不了
  8. Excel/WPS表格怎么设置输入密码才能打开文件
  9. 企业多园区统一灾备建设最佳实践
  10. 基于麻雀搜索算法优化的Elman神经网络数据预测 - 附代码
  11. PG性能调校(二):数据库硬件及基准评测
  12. Unity——网络游戏通信方案
  13. 在WINDOWS下的Services.mscl里有好几个ORACLE的SERVICES的一些作用
  14. 上海出租车价格计算器
  15. C++学习笔记-STL
  16. CV领域的对比学习综述(下)
  17. 相机视野拉伸,设置相机的Field Of View改变视野的大小
  18. codevs 2964 公共素数因数
  19. ojbk的sas proc 过程之freq
  20. idea中git代码回滚

热门文章

  1. GCC编译过程以及对应FILE文件表
  2. c++-内存管理-bitmap_alloctor
  3. CRC循环校验码原理及计算举例
  4. windows使用nginx实现网站负载均衡测试实例
  5. MongoDB分布式操作——分片操作
  6. 美国次级贷款来龙去脉
  7. 【转】Create Hello-JNI with Android Studio
  8. 苹果Xcode帮助文档阅读指南
  9. org.apache.commons.lang.StringUtils
  10. SpringMVC解决前台传入的数组或集合类型数据